Output d0885473bb5ae96d204e42ab4904453b291cf58d955df8756076ce7d086b1ed8:1

value
4015503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e14e70c91ab2b88a633378ac52b6a13d59d47e62 OP_EQUAL
address
3NEKvrMtKWQSLbRCT91TtUn6j7wwPy9eoJ
transaction
d0885473bb5ae96d204e42ab4904453b291cf58d955df8756076ce7d086b1ed8
confirmations
421125
spent
true